Abstract
A gasoline pump system for the concurrent filling of more than one car, tank or container with gasoline or other liquid petroleum products comprising: a plurality of fuel outlets, each for delivering a predefined type of fuel, wherein each outlet is supplied by a fuel pump from a reservoir containing one type of fuel and further including a flowmeter for measuring the amount of fuel delivered; a plurality of sets of interface means with a station operator, each set relating to one serviced car, wherein each set comprises input means for selecting the type of fuel for that serviced car and display means for indicating a filling status for that car; and a digital controller comprising an output for activating pumps for desired fuel types responsive to electrical signals received from the sets of interface means, input means for receiving signals indicative of the amount of fuel delivered from each of the flowmeter means, computer means for computing filling-related status information and for outputting the status information for each type of fuel to the display means in the interface sets.

11. In a gasoline pump system comprising a plurality of fuel outlets, each for delivering a predefined type of fuel, a plurality of sets of interface means with a station operator, each relating to one serviced car, and digital controller means comprising output means for activating pumps for desired fuel types responsive to electrical signals received from the sets of interface means, input means for receiving signals indicative of the amount of fuel delivered and computer means for computing filling-related status information, a method for concurrent filling of a plurality of cars, comprising the steps of:
-
A. choosing a desired fuel type for a first car arriving at the gasoline pump system;
B. filling the first car with the desired fuel type, with a display means indicating filling-related information;
C. choosing a desired fuel type for a second car arriving at the gasoline pump system while a first car is filling, and wherein limiting the type of fuel for the second car to a type that is available there; and
D. filling the second car with the desired fuel type, with a display means indicating filling-related information. - View Dependent Claims (12, 13, 14, 15, 16, 17, 18, 19, 20)
